Abstract
Relatively little research has been done in recent years to understand what leads to the unceasingly high rates of HIV sensory neuropathy despite successful antiretroviral treatment. In vivo and in vitro studies demonstrate neuronal damage induced by HIV and increasingly identified ART neurotoxicity involving mitochondrial dysfunction and innate immune system activation in peripheral nerves, ultimately all pathways resulting in enhanced pro-inflammatory cytokine secretion. Furthermore, many infectious/autoimmune/malignant diseases are influenced by the production-profile of pro-inflammatory and anti-inflammatory cytokines, due to inter-individual allelic polymorphism within cytokine gene regulatory regions. Associations of cytokine gene polymorphisms are investigated with the aim of identifying potential genetic markers for susceptibility to HIV peripheral neuropathy including ART-dependent toxic neuropathy. One hundred seventy-one people living with HIV in Northern Greece, divided into two sub-groups according to the presence/absence of peripheral neuropathy, were studied over a 5-year period. Diagnosis was based on the Brief Peripheral Neuropathy Screening. Cytokine genotyping was performed by sequence-specific primer-polymerase chain reaction. Present study findings identify age as an important risk factor (p < 0.01) and support the idea that cytokine gene polymorphisms are at least involved in HIV peripheral-neuropathy pathogenesis. Specifically, carriers of IL1a-889/rs1800587 TT genotype and IL4-1098/rs2243250 GG genotype disclosed greater relative risk for developing HIV peripheral neuropathy (OR: 2.9 and 7.7 respectively), while conversely, carriers of IL2+166/rs2069763 TT genotype yielded lower probability (OR: 3.1), all however, with marginal statistical significance. The latter, if confirmed in a larger Greek population cohort, may offer in the future novel genetic markers to identify susceptibility, while it remains significant that further ethnicity-oriented studies continue to be conducted in a similar pursuit.

Abstract
The incidence of multidrug-resistant (MDR) bloodstream infections (BSIs) is associated with high morbidity and mortality. Little evidence exists regarding the epidemiology of BSIs and the use of appropriate empirical antimicrobial therapy in endemic regions. Novel diagnostic tests (RDTs) may facilitate and improve patient management. Data were assessed from patients with MDR Gram-negative bacteremia at a university tertiary hospital over a 12-month period. In total, 157 episodes of MDR Gram-negative BSI were included in the study. The overall mortality rate was 50.3%. Rapid molecular diagnostic tests were used in 94% of BSI episodes. In univariate analysis, age (OR 1.05 (95% CI 1.03, 1.08) p < 0.001), Charlson Comorbidity Index (OR 1.51 (95% CI 1.25, 1.83) p < 0.001), procalcitonin ≥ 1(OR 3.67 (CI 95% 1.73, 7.79) p < 0.001), and monotherapy with tigecycline (OR 3.64 (95% CI 1.13, 11.73) p = 0.030) were the only factors associated with increased overall mortality. Surprisingly, time to appropriate antimicrobial treatment had no impact on mortality. MDR pathogen isolation, other than Klebsiella pneumoniae and Acinetobacter baumanii, was associated with decreased mortality (OR 0.35 (95% CI 0.16, 0.79) p = 0.011). In multivariate analysis, the only significant factor for mortality was procalcitonin ≥ 1 (OR 2.84 (95% CI 1.13, 7.11) p = 0.025). In conclusion, in an endemic area, mortality rates in MDR BSI remain notable. High procalcitonin was the only variable that predicted death. The use of rapid diagnostics did not improve mortality rate.

Abstract
OBJECTIVES HIV late presentation (LP) has been increasing in recent years in Europe. Our aim was to investigate the characteristics of LP in Greece using in addition to the traditional definition for LP, the time interval between HIV infection and diagnosis. METHODS Our nationwide sample included HIV-1 sequences generated from 6166 people living with HIV (PLWH) in Greece during the period 1999-2015. Our analysis was based on the molecularly inferred HIV-1 infection dates for PLWH infected within local molecular transmission clusters of subtypes A1 and B. RESULTS Analysis of the determinants of LP was conducted using either CD4 counts or AIDS-defining condition at diagnosis or the time from infection to diagnosis. Older age, heterosexual transmission risk group and more recent diagnosis were associated with increased risk for LP. In contrast to previous studies, people who inject drugs (PWID) had a shorter median time to diagnosis (0.63 years) compared to men who have sex with men (MSM) (1.72 years) and heterosexuals (2.43 years). Using HIV infection dates that provide an unbiased marker for LP compared to CD4 counts at diagnosis, which are age-dependent, we estimated that the time to diagnosis increased gradually with age. Migrants infected regionally do not differ with respect to LP status compared to native Greeks. CONCLUSIONS We demonstrate that older people and heterosexuals are among those at higher risk for LP; and given the growing number of older people among newly diagnosed cases, tailored interventions are needed in these populations.

Abstract
BACKGROUND Peripheral neuropathy is among the most common complications among people with HIV with prevalence rates varying widely among studies (10-58%). OBJECTIVE This study aims to assess the prevalence of HIV-associated peripheral neuropathy among HIV-positive people in Northern Greece monitored during the last 5-year period and investigate possible correlations with antiretroviral therapy, disease staging, and potential risk factors, as there is no prior epidemiological record in Greek patients. METHODS Four hundred twenty patients were divided into a group with peripheral neuropathy (n = 269), and those without (n = 151). Peripheral neuropathy was assessed with a validated Peripheral Neuropathy Screening tool. Statistical analyses were performed with SPSS, were two-tailed, and p-value was set at 0.05. RESULTS The incidence of peripheral neuropathy was estimated at 35.9%. Age was found to correlate with higher odds of developing HIV-peripheral neuropathy, rising by 4%/year. Females encountered 77% higher probability to develop peripheral neuropathy. Stage 3 of the disease associated with higher occurrence of peripheral neuropathy (96% as compared to stage-1 patients). Among patients with peripheral neuropathy, the duration of antiretroviral therapy was found to be longer than in those without. CONCLUSIONS Peripheral neuropathy remains one of the most common complications regardless of the antiretroviral-therapy type, indicating the involvement of other risk factors in its occurrence, such as the stage of the disease, age and gender. Therefore, the treating physician should screen patients as early and frequently as possible upon HIV-diagnosis to prevent the progression of this debilitating condition so that prolonged life-expectancy is accompanied by a good quality of life.

Abstract
INTRODUCTION Aging is characterized as a syndrome of deleterious, progressive, universal, and irreversible function changes affecting every structural and functional aspect of the organism and accompanied by a generalized increase in mortality. Although a substantial number of candidates for biomarkers of aging have been proposed, none has been validated or universally accepted. Human telomeres constitute hexameric repetitive DNA sequence nucleoprotein complexes that cap chromosome ends, regulating gene expression and modulating stress-related pathways. Telomere length (TL) shortening is observed both in cellular senescence and advanced age, leading to the investigation of TL as a biomarker for aging and a risk factor indicator for the development and progression of the most common age-related diseases. OBJECTIVE The present review underlines the connection between TL and the pathophysiology of the diseases associated with telomere attrition. METHODS We performed a structured search of the PubMed database for peer-reviewed research of the literature regarding leukocyte TL and cardiovascular diseases (CVD), more specifically stroke and heart disease, and focused on the relevant articles published during the last 5 years. We also applied Hill's criteria of causation to strengthen this association. RESULTS We analyzed the recent literature regarding TL length, stroke, and CVD. Although approximately one-third of the available studies support the connection, the results of different studies seem to be rather conflicting as a result of different study designs, divergent methods of TL determination, small study samples, and patient population heterogeneity. After applying Hill's criteria, we can observe that the literature conforms to them weakly, with chronology being the only Hill criterion of causality that probably cannot be contested. CONCLUSION The present review attempted to examine the purported relation between leukocyte TL and age-related diseases such as CVD and more specific stroke and heart disease in view of the best established, comprehensive, medical and epidemiological criteria that have characterized the focused recent relevant research. Although several recommendations have been made that may contribute significantly to the field, a call for novel technical approaches and studies is mandatory to further elucidate the possible association.

Abstract
Background Influenza virus infection is associated with increased morbidity and mortality in patients with diabetes mellitus. Public health authorities recommend yearly vaccination of diabetic patients against seasonal influenza. Methods We surveyed to define the adherence to influenza vaccination and associated factors among diabetic patients in Thessaloniki, Greece. Predictors of adherence to yearly influenza vaccination were assessed with logistic regression models. Results A total of 206 patients were enrolled, with 47.1% reporting yearly vaccination against influenza (95% confidence interval, CI:40.3% to 53.9%). In univariate models, the absence of additional indications for vaccination was associated with a decreased likelihood of vaccination uptake (OR:0.29, 95% CI:0.11 to 0.68, p=0.007); older diabetic patients were more likely to receive influenza vaccination (34% increase per 10 years of age). These associations were attenuated in multivariable analysis. Conclusion Our study demonstrates a significant gap in influenza vaccination coverage rate in diabetic patients. Our data could be extrapolated to enhance the uptake of vaccines against SARS-CoV-2: emphasis should be placed on patient education.

Abstract
Our aim was to estimate the date of the origin and the transmission rates of the major local clusters of subtypes A1 and B in Greece. Phylodynamic analyses were conducted in 14 subtype A1 and 31 subtype B clusters. The earliest dates of origin for subtypes A1 and B were in 1982.6 and in 1985.5, respectively. The transmission rate for the subtype A1 clusters ranged between 7.54 and 39.61 infections/100 person years (IQR: 9.39, 15.88), and for subtype B clusters between 4.42 and 36.44 infections/100 person years (IQR: 7.38, 15.04). Statistical analysis revealed that the average difference in the transmission rate between the PWID and the MSM clusters was 6.73 (95% CI: 0.86 to 12.60; p = 0.026). Our study provides evidence that the date of introduction of subtype A1 in Greece was the earliest in Europe. Transmission rates were significantly higher for PWID than MSM clusters due to the conditions that gave rise to an extensive PWID HIV-1 outbreak ten years ago in Athens, Greece. Transmission rate can be considered as a valuable measure for public health since it provides a proxy of the rate of epidemic growth within a cluster and, therefore, it can be useful for targeted HIV prevention programs.

Abstract
Nasopharyngeal swab specimen (NPS) molecular testing is considered the gold standard for SARS-CoV-2 detection. However, saliva is an attractive, noninvasive specimen alternative. The aim of the study was to evaluate the diagnostic accuracy of Advanta Dx SARS-CoV-2 RT-PCR saliva-based assay against paired NPS tested with either NeumoDxTM SARS-CoV-2 assay or Abbott Real Time SARS-CoV-2 assay as the reference method. We prospectively evaluated the method in two settings: a diagnostic outpatient and a healthcare worker screening convenience sample, collected in November-December 2020. SARS-CoV-2 was detected in 27.7% (61/220) of diagnostic samples and in 5% (10/200) of screening samples. Overall, saliva test in diagnostic samples had a sensitivity of 88.5% (77.8-95.3%) and specificity of 98.1% (94.6-99.6%); in screening samples, the sensitivity was 90% (55.5-99.7%) and specificity 100% (98.1-100%). Our data suggests that the Fluidigm Advanta Dx RT-PCR saliva-based assay may be a reliable diagnostic tool for COVID-19 diagnosis in symptomatic individuals and screening asymptomatic healthcare workers.

Abstract
Background: Erdheim-Chester disease (ECD) is a rare hematopoietic neoplasm of histiocytic origin characterized by an insidious course. The coronavirus disease 2019 (COVID-19) pandemic has put an enormous strain on healthcare systems worldwide both directly and indirectly, resulting in the disruption of healthcare services to prevent, diagnose and manage non-COVID-19 disease. Case Presentation: We describe the case of a 58-year-old male patient with sporadic episodes of self-resolving mild fever and anemia of chronic disease with onset two years before the current presentation. Positron emission/computed tomography scan revealed the presence of moderately hypermetabolic perirenal tissue masses. In order to achieve diagnosis, repeated perirenal tissue biopsies were performed, and the diagnostic evaluation was complicated by the strain put on the healthcare system by the COVID-19 pandemic. The patient contracted SARS-CoV-2 and required hospitalization, but recovered fully. No further ECD target organ involvement was documented. Treatment options were presented, but the patient chose to defer treatment for ECD. Conclusion: A high index of suspicion and multidisciplinary team collaboration is paramount to achieve diagnosis in rare conditions such as ECD. Disruptions in healthcare services in the pandemic milieu may disproportionately affect people with rare diseases and further study and effort is required to better meet their needs in the pandemic setting.

Abstract
WHAT IS KNOWN AND OBJECTIVE Hyperhaemolytic transfusion reactions are rare life-threatening events predominantly affecting patients with haemoglobinopathies. We report two cases in β-thalassaemia major patients on chronic transfusion therapy and highlight the role of eculizumab in its management. CASE SUMMARY Patient 1 presented with intravascular haemolysis on day 7 (D7) post-transfusion and responded to treatment with corticosteroids and intravenous immunoglobulin. However, patient 2 presented with severe symptomatic anaemia (D4 post-transfusion) unresponsive to the aforementioned measures. Eculizumab administration led to resolution of the hyperhaemolysis. WHAT IS NEW AND CONCLUSION We report the successful management of hyperhaemolysis with eculizumab in a β-thalassemia major patient.

Abstract
BACKGROUND The incidence of diabetes mellitus (DM) is ever-increasing and along with its microvascular and macrovascular complications, it is associated with a high morbidity and mortality burden globally. Major components of diabetes pathophysiology include glucotoxicity, lipotoxicity and insulin resistance, disturbing the vascular wall integrity and leading to endothelial dysfunction and platelet hyper aggregation. OBJECTIVE This review aims to identify and summarize the effect of novel anti-diabetic agents (glucagon-like peptide-1 receptor agonists, dipeptidyl peptidase-4 inhibitors, sodium-glucose co-transporter -2 inhibitors) on endothelial (EF) and platelet function (PF) and evaluate the consistency with the results of cardiovascular outcomes studies. METHODS We performed a structured search of the PubMed database for peer-reviewed research of the literature between 1981 and 2020 regarding the effect of DM and novel antidiabetic agents on EF and PF. RESULTS We analyzed data regarding the effect of novel anti-diabetic agents on EF and PF as well as the pathophysiological interplay between DM, PF, and EF. The available studies use different methods to evaluate these outcomes and the results of different studies are rather conflicting as a result of different study designs, combinations of drugs tested, small study samples and patient population heterogeneity. CONCLUSION The currently available data do not unequivocally support a consistent effect of novel antidiabetic agents on EF and PF. Further study is required ideally for the validation of the results with clinical outcomes.

Abstract
Background and objectives: The circadian pattern seems to play a crucial role in cardiovascular events and arrhythmias. Diabetes mellitus is a complex metabolic disorder associated with autonomic nervous system alterations and increased risk of microvascular and macrovascular disease. We sought to determine whether acute myocardial infarction (AMI) and atrial fibrillation (AF) follow a circadian pattern in diabetic patients in a Mediterranean country. Materials and Methods: This retrospective study included 178 diabetic patients (mean age: 67.7) with AMI or AF who were admitted to the coronary care unit. The circadian pattern of AMI and AF was identified in the 24-h period (divided in 3-h and 1-h intervals). Patients were also divided in 3 groups according to age; 40-65 years, 66-79 years and patients older than 80 years. A chi-square goodness-of-fit test was used for the statistical analysis. Results: AMI seems to occur more often in the midnight hours (21:00-23:59) (p < 0.001). Regarding age distribution, patients between 40 and 65 years were more likely to experience an AMI compared to other age groups (p < 0.001). Autonomic alterations, working habits, and social reasons might contribute to this phenomenon. AF in diabetic patients occurs more frequently at noon (12:00-14:59) (p = 0.019). Conclusions: Diabetic patients with AMI and AF seem to follow a specific circadian pattern in a Mediterranean country, with AMI occurring most often at midnight hours and AF mostly at noon. Autonomic dysfunction, glycemic fluctuations, intense anti-diabetic treatment before lunch, and patterns of insulin secretion and resistance may explain this pattern. More studies are needed to elucidate the circadian pattern of AMI and AF in diabetic patients to contribute to the development of new therapeutic approaches in this setting.

Abstract
RATIONALE Dasatinib associated lymphadenopathy (DAL) is a rare adverse event in chronic myeloid leukemia patients (CML). A case of voluminous lymphadenopathy in the context of DAL is presented. PATIENT CONCERNS A 40-year-old male patient was diagnosed with BCR-ABL1 positive chronic stage CML 2 years ago and achieved complete molecular response on nilotinib, which was switched to dasatinib due to nilotinib intolerance. After 5 months on dasatinib, the patient presented with a large mass in the axillary region. DIAGNOSIS Common infectious and autoimmune etiologies of lymphadenopathy were ruled out. The positron emission tomography/computed tomography (PET/CT) demonstrated a hypermetabolic lymphadenopathy highly suspicious of lymphoma. The subsequent biopsy excluded lymphoma or extramedullary blastic transformation of CML and revealed reactive lymphadenopathy with mixed (cortical and paracortical) pattern. Clinical history and clinicopathological correlation suggested the diagnosis of DAL. INTERVENTION Dasatinib was discontinued and the patient remained in close follow-up. TKI treatment with nilotinib was reinitiated. OUTCOMES Lymphadenopathy resolved clinically at 4 weeks and normalization of PET/CT findings was documented at 9 weeks after cessation of the drug. TKI treatment with nilotinib was reinitiated with good tolerance. LESSONS DAL may present with voluminous lymphadenopathy consistent with malignancy in clinical and imaging workup. We describe the spectrum of lesions associated with DAL and identify common features with drug-induced lymphadenopathy.

Abstract
HbA1c is a biomarker with a central role in the diagnosis and follow-up of patients with diabetes, although not a perfect one. Common comorbidities encountered in patients with diabetes mellitus, such as renal insufficiency, high output states (iron deficiency anaemia, haemolytic anaemia, haemoglobinopathies and pregnancy) and intake of specific drugs could compromise the sensitivity and specificity of the biomarker. COVID-19 pandemic poses a pressing challenge for the diabetic population, since maintaining optimal blood glucose control is key to reduce morbidity and mortality rates. Alternative methods for diabetes management, such as fructosamine, glycosylated albumin and device-based continuous glucose monitoring, are discussed.

Abstract
RATIONALE Multiple system atrophy is a late-onset rare neurodegenerative movement disorder which results in debilitating disease. Fever frequently ensues in the context of infections which can be associated with significant morbidity and mortality, but among alternative diagnostic possibilities neoplasms and autoimmune disorders should be considered. PATIENT CONCERNS We describe a case of a prolonged febrile syndrome in a 55-year-old female patient with onset of multiple system atrophy two years before presentation. Patient history and symptoms were not contributive to guide the diagnostic work-up. DIAGNOSIS Initial evaluation provided no specific findings. Repeat testing of auto-antibodies revealed positive antinuclear and anti-ds DNA antibodies coupled with low complement which in conjunction with renal biopsy substantiated the diagnosis of systemic lupus erythematosus flare. INTERVENTION Pending the biopsy result, treatment with hydroxychloroquine and corticosteroids was initiated. Due to failure to achieve remission, azathioprine was added, but symptoms persisted. Following the diagnosis of lupus nephritis, azathioprine was discontinued and induction treatment with cyclophosphamide in accordance with the Euro-Lupus regimen was initiated and upon completion followed by maintenance therapy with mycophenolate mofetil. OUTCOMES The patient achieved remission after cyclophosphamide was added to treatment with corticosteroids and has not experienced new flares during the next two years. The neurological syndrome has remained stable during this period. LESSONS To our knowledge, we report the first case of concurrent systemic lupus erythematosus and multiple system atrophy. Prolonged fever presents unique challenges in patients with rare diseases.

Abstract
OBJECTIVES Despite successful virological suppression, HIV transcription frequently persists intracellularly. In this study, we hypothesize that HIV persistent transcription(HIVpt) may affect to a different extent patients on stable efavirenz(EFV) versus atazanavir(ATV)-based regimens. The role of the expression of drug efflux transporters in HIVpt was also investigated. METHODS We prospectively enrolled 51 virologically suppressed patients on first-line treatment for one year with EFV or ATV combined with emtricitabine and tenofovir and followed them up for one year. Simultaneous ultrasensitive subpopulation staining/hybridization in situ(SUSHI) was performed to identify HIVpt in CD4+ T-cells and in the CD4+CD45RO+ T-cell subpopulation. The differential mRNA expression of P-glycoprotein(P-gp/ABCB1) and multidrug resistance-associated protein-1(MRP1/ABCC1) was also evaluated. Univariate logistic regression models were used to evaluate predictors of HIVpt. RESULTS In the CD4+ T-cell population, HIVpt affected 13/30 of patients on EFV versus 10/21 on ATV. In the CD4+CD45RO+ T-cell population, HIVpt was present in 14/30 of patients on EFV versus 15/21 on ATV. A trend for association was observed between the risk of HIVpt and ATV treatment in the CD4+CD45RO+ T-cell population (OR 2.86, 95% CI 0.87-9.37, p = 0.083). HIVpt status was not associated with loss of virological suppression or CD4 evolution. We found no evidence of differential expression of the drug efflux transporters P-gp and MRP1. CONCLUSIONS Further study is required to evaluate whether the HIVpt profile in specific cell populations may differ across different antiretroviral regimens and to elucidate the potential clinical impact.

Abstract
AIM To evaluate alterations of memory B cell subpopulations during a 48-wk period in human immunodeficiency virus type 1 (HIV-1) patients.
METHODS Forty-one antiretroviral naïve and 41 treated HIV-1 patients matched for age and duration of HIV infection were recruited. All clinical, epidemiological and laboratory data were recorded or measured. The different B cell subsets were characterized according to their surface markers: Total B cells (CD19+), memory B cells (CD19+CD27+, BMCs), resting BMCs (CD19+CD27+CD21high, RM), exhausted BMCs (CD19+CD21lowCD27-, EM), IgM memory B (CD19+CD27+IgMhigh), isotype-switched BMCs (CD19+CD27+IgM-, ITS) and activated BMCs (CD19+CD21low+CD27+, AM) at baseline on week 4 and week 48.
RESULTS Mean counts of BMCs were higher in treated patients. There was a marginal upward trend of IgM memory B cell proportions which differed significantly in the treated group (overall trend, P = 0.004). ITS BMC increased over time significantly in all patients. Naive patients had of lower levels of EM B cells compared to treated, with a downward trend, irrespectively of highly active antiretroviral therapy (HAART) intake. Severe impairment of EM B cells was recorded to both treated (P = 0.024) and naive (P = 0.023) and patients. Higher proportions of RM cells were noted in HAART group, which differed significantly on week 4th (P = 0.017) and 48th (P = 0.03). Higher levels of AM were preserved in HAART naive group during the whole study period (week 4: P = 0.018 and 48: P = 0.035). HIV-RNA viremia strongly correlated with AM B cells (r = 0.54, P = 0.01) and moderately with RM cells (r = -0.45, P = 0.026) at baseline.
CONCLUSION HIV disrupts memory B cell subpopulations leading to impaired immunologic memory over time. BMC, RM, EM and ITS BMC were higher in patients under HAART. Activated BMCs (AM) were higher in patients without HAART. Viremia correlated with AM and RM. Significant depletion was recorded in EM B cells irrespectively of HAART intake. Perturbations in BMC-populations are not fully restored by antiretrovirals.

Abstract
Viral load testing is a valuable tool in HIV clinical care and research. Discrepancies among diverse viral load assays, especially with regard to non-B HIV-1 subtypes have been reported. Our study aimed to explore the impact of HIV subtype (B versus non-B) on the agreement between CAP/CTM, v2.0 and m2000 RealTime in treated HIV patients, focusing on low viral loads (<200 copies/ml). Our findings indicate that there is a significant difference in the performance of the compared assays in the low-viremic range and non-B subtypes, suggesting that a single assay should be used for follow-up.

Abstract
BACKGROUND Allergic rhinitis affects a significant proportion of the European population. Few surveys have investigated this disorder in Greek adults. Our objective was to describe the characteristics of patients with allergic rhinitis in an adult outpatient clinic in Thessaloniki, Greece. METHODS We studied the medical records of adult patients referred to a Clinical Immunology outpatient clinic from 2001 to 2007. The diagnostic procedure was not changed during the whole study period, including the same questionnaire used at the time of diagnosis, skin prick tests, and serum specific IgE. RESULTS A total of 1851 patient files with diagnosed allergies were analysed and allergic rhinitis was confirmed in 711 subjects (38.4%). According to ARIA classification, persistent allergic rhinitis was more prevalent than intermittent (54.9% vs. 45.1%), while 60.8% of subjects suffered from moderate/severe disease. In multivariable analysis, factors associated with allergic rhinitis were age (for every 10 years increase, OR: 0.84, 95% CI: 0.77-0.91; p<0.001); working in school environment (teachers or students) (OR: 1.46, 95% CI: 1.05-2.02; p=0.023); parental history of respiratory allergy (OR: 2.41, 95% CI: 1.69-3.43; p<0.001); smoking (OR: 0.71, 95% CI: 0.55-0.91; p=0.007); presence of allergic conjunctivitis (OR: 6.16, 95% CI: 4.71-8.06; p<0.001); and asthma (OR: 2.17, 95% CI: 1.57-3.01; p<0.001). Analysis after multiple imputation corroborated the complete case analysis results. CONCLUSIONS Allergic rhinitis was documented in 38.4% of studied patients and was frequently characterised by significant morbidity. Factors associated with allergic rhinitis provide insight into the epidemiology of this disorder in our region. Further studies on the general population would contribute to evaluating allergic rhinitis more comprehensively.

Abstract
OBJECTIVE To assess the extent to which meta-analysis publications of drugs and biologics focus on specific named agents or even only a single agent, and identify characteristics associated with such focus. STUDY DESIGN AND SETTING We evaluated 499 articles with meta-analyses published in 2010 and estimated how many did not cover all the available comparisons of tested interventions for a given condition (not all-inclusive); focused on specific named agent(s), or focused strictly on comparisons of only one specific active agent vs. placebo/no treatment or different doses/schedules. RESULTS Of 499 eligible articles, 403 (80.8%) were not all-inclusive, 214 (42.9%) covered only specific named agent(s), and 74 (14.8%) examined only comparisons with one active agent vs. placebo/no treatment or different doses/schedules. Only 39 articles (7.8%) covered all possible indications for the examined agent(s). After adjusting for type of treatment/field, focus on specific named agent(s) was associated with publication in journal venues (odds ratio [OR]: 1.95; 95% confidence interval [CI]: 1.17-3.26) vs. Cochrane, industry sponsoring (OR: 3.94; 95% CI: 1.66-10.66), and individual patient data analyses (OR: 6.59; 95% CI: 2.24-19.39). Individual patient data analyses primarily (29/34) focused on specific named agent(s). CONCLUSION The scope of meta-analysis publications frequently is narrow and shaped to serve particular agents.

Abstract
We conducted a retrospective study on the prevalence and correlates of transmitted drug resistance among newly-diagnosed antiretroviral naive human immunodeficiency virus (HIV) patients in Northern Greece, during the period 2009-11. Transmitted drug resistance was documented in 21.8% of patients enrolled, affecting approximately 40% of subtype A HIV-1-infected individuals. Overcoming challenges due to the ongoing financial crisis, effective preventive measures should be implemented to control further dissemination of resistant HIV strains.

Abstract
OBJECTIVES To determine the contribution of transmission clusters to transmitted drug resistance (TDR) in newly diagnosed antiretroviral-naive HIV-1-infected patients in Northern Greece during 2000-07. METHODS The prevalence of TDR was estimated in 369 individuals who were diagnosed with HIV-1 infection in the period 2000-07 at the National AIDS Reference Laboratory of Northern Greece. Phylogenetic analysis was performed using a maximum likelihood method on partial pol sequences. TDR was defined in accordance with the surveillance drug resistance mutation list (2009 update). RESULTS The overall prevalence of TDR in our population was 12.5% [46/369, 95% confidence interval (CI) 9.1%-15.8%], comprising 7.6% (28/369) resistant to nucleoside reverse transcriptase inhibitors, 5.4% (20/369) resistant to non-nucleoside reverse transcriptase inhibitors and 3.3% (12/369) resistant to protease inhibitors. Dual class resistance was identified in 3.8% (14/369). Infection with subtype A was the sole predictor associated with TDR in multivariate analysis (odds ratio 2.15, 95% CI 1.10-4.19, P = 0.025). Phylogenetic analyses revealed three statistically robust transmission clusters involving drug-resistant strains, including one cluster of 12 patients, 10 of whom were infected with a strain carrying both T215 revertants and Y181C mutations. CONCLUSIONS Our findings underline the substantial impact of transmission networks on TDR in our population.
